Newspaper reports earlier this year indicated that the Federal Government is planning to restrict the ability of independent contractors to own and control their own self-managed super funds (SMSFs). SMSFs also seem to be the target of the big industry and retail super funds.
ICA believes that Independent Contractors have a right to control their own retirement funds if they wish and to decide how those funds are invested. This is particularly important given the global financial crisis.
ICA is therefore conducting a campaign to defend the right of independent contractors to own and manage their own super funds. While acknowledging that there are some useful government initiatives (notably education about the legal obligations faced by SMSF owners), ICA will vigorously oppose any attempt, by government or others, to limit Independent Contractors' access to, and control over, one of the key elements of their financial independence.
